Hi, I try to start an X application from a script, which is not called from X. This works with the Xfce desktop, but does not with Gnome3.
The script sets DISPLAY=:0 and HOME to the user that owns the X session. The application is started with user and group permissions for the user that owns the X session. Here is the strace output that causes the error: socket(PF_FILE, SOCK_STREAM|SOCK_CLOEXEC, 0) = 3 connect(3, {sa_family=AF_FILE, path=@"/tmp/.X11-unix/X0"}, 20) = 0 getpeername(3, {sa_family=AF_FILE, path=@"/tmp/.X11-unix/X0"}, [20]) = 0 uname({sys="Linux", node="mac", ...}) = 0 access("/home/scorpion/.Xauthority", R_OK) = 0 open("/home/scorpion/.Xauthority", O_RDONLY) = 4 fstat(4, {st_mode=S_IFREG|0600, st_size=147, ...}) = 0 mmap(NULL, 4096, PROT_READ|PROT_WRITE, MAP_PRIVATE|MAP_ANONYMOUS, -1, 0) = 0x7f14373eb000 read(4, "\1\0\0\3mac\0\00212\0\22MIT-MAGIC-COOKIE-1\0"..., 4096) = 147 read(4, "", 4096) = 0 close(4) = 0 munmap(0x7f14373eb000, 4096) = 0 fcntl(3, F_GETFL) = 0x2 (flags O_RDWR) fcntl(3, F_SETFL, O_RDWR|O_NONBLOCK) = 0 fcntl(3, F_SETFD, FD_CLOEXEC) = 0 poll([{fd=3, events=POLLIN|POLLOUT}], 1, -1) = 1 ([{fd=3, revents=POLLOUT}]) writev(3, [{"l\0\v\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0", 12}, {"", 0}], 2) = 12 read(3, "\0\26\v\0\0\0\6\0", 8) = 8 read(3, "No protocol specified\n\0\0", 24) = 24 write(2, "No protocol specified\n", 22No protocol specified ) = 22 close(3) = 0 Any hints what I'm doing wrong?
